The injuries of spleen and intestinal immune system induced by 2-Gy <sup>60</sup>Co <b>γ</b>-ray whole-body irradiation

The aim of the present study was to investigate the injuries of spleen and intestinal immune system induced by 2 Gy <sup>60</sup>Co γ ray in mice. A total of 120 Balb/c mice were randomly divided into two groups: blank control (Ctrl) and model (IR). The IR mice were exposed to a single dose of total body irradiation (2 Gy, dose rate: 1 Gy/min) and sacrificed on 1st, 3rd, 7th, 14th and 21st day after irradiation. The indicators including general observations and body weight, the changes in peripheral hemogram, spleen index, histopathology examination and lymphocyte subsets of spleen. As well as the count and subsets of lymphocyte in gut-associated lymphoid tissue. Compared with the Ctrl group, the body weight, spleen index, peripheral blood cell and splenocyte amounts, intraepithelial lymphocytes number decreased significantly after exposure, accompanied by a notable decreased count of lymphocytes in Peyer’s patch and mesenteric lymph nodes. Moreover, ionizing radiation also broke the balance of CD4+/CD8+ and increased the Treg proportion in spleen, which then triggered immune imbalance and immunosuppression. In general, the spleen injuries occurred on 1st day after exposure, worse on 3rd day, and were relieved on 7th day. The intestinal immune injuries were observed on 1st day, and attenuated on 3rd day. On 21st day after exposure, the spleen volume and index have returned to normal, except for the distribution of lymphocyte subpopulations. Furthermore, all indicators of gut-associated lymphoid tissue, except for mesenteric lymph nodes lymphocyte count, had returned to normal levels on 21st day. In conclusion, our data showed the injuries of spleen and intestinal immune system induced by 2 Gy <sup>60</sup>Co γ ray whole-body irradiation. These findings may provide the bases for further radiation protection in the immunity.

本研究旨在探究2 Gy 钴-60(⁶⁰Co)γ射线对小鼠脾脏与肠道免疫系统造成的损伤。共计120只Balb/c小鼠被随机分为两组:空白对照组(Ctrl)与模型组(IR)。模型组小鼠接受单次全身照射(剂量为2 Gy,剂量率:1 Gy/min),并分别于照射后第1、3、7、14及21天处死取材。检测指标涵盖一般状态观察与体重变化、外周血象变化、脾脏指数测定、组织病理学检查以及脾脏淋巴细胞亚群分析,同时包括肠道相关淋巴组织中淋巴细胞的计数与亚群分布检测。与空白对照组相比,照射后小鼠体重、脾脏指数、外周血细胞及脾细胞数量均显著下降,肠上皮内淋巴细胞数量亦随之减少,派尔集合淋巴结(Peyer’s patch)与肠系膜淋巴结(mesenteric lymph nodes)中的淋巴细胞计数同样显著降低。此外,电离辐射还破坏了脾脏内CD4⁺/CD8⁺的比值平衡,并升高了调节性T细胞(Treg)的占比,进而引发免疫失衡与免疫抑制。整体而言,脾脏损伤于照射后第1天出现,第3天病情加重,至第7天有所缓解;肠道免疫损伤则于照射后第1天被观测到,第3天呈减轻趋势。照射后第21天,小鼠脾脏体积与脾脏指数均恢复至正常水平,仅淋巴细胞亚群分布尚未恢复正常。此外,除肠系膜淋巴结淋巴细胞计数外,肠道相关淋巴组织的各项指标均于第21天恢复至正常水平。综上,本研究数据证实了2 Gy ⁶⁰Co γ射线全身照射可诱发小鼠脾脏与肠道免疫系统损伤。上述研究结果可为后续免疫相关辐射防护研究提供理论依据。
